Wait, What’s a Virtual Assistant?

Great question! A virtual assistant is like that super-organized friend with a color-coded planner. They handle administrative, technical, or creative tasks—all remotely. No office space or coffee runs. They’re pros at tackling the jobs that make you want to pull your hair out.

Why You and Your Business Need a VA

1. Time is Money! Let’s be honest; half your day is spent on tasks that don’t exactly scream “CEO energy.” Imagine having someone else handle your inbox or schedule so you can focus on—I don’t know—growing your business. A VA gives you time to do what you do best—like being a creative genius.

2. Efficiency is VAs superpowers. They’ve mastered tools and tricks to get things done faster than you can say “spreadsheet.” Plus, they’re pros at organizing chaos. Do you have a system that’s more tangled than last year? They’ll untangle it.


3. Hiring full-time help might not be in your budget, but a VA? That’s a cost-effective solution. You pay for the hours or tasks you need without strings attached.


4. Less Stress, More Zen – Imagine waking up and not immediately overwhelmed by your overflowing inbox. Dreamy, right? A VA can take the stress off your plate, leaving you with more headspace—or at least more space to relax.

Make Hiring a VA Your Best Resolution Yet

Here’s the deal: 2025 can be the year you finally stop trying to do everything yourself. Start by jotting down the tasks that make you groan or scream. Then, find a VA who’s a perfect fit for those jobs. Websites like Upwork and Fiverr are goldmines, and virtual assistant agencies can match you with someone who gets your vibe. Bonus: most VAs specialize in working with small businesses, so they’re already in your corner.
